What they do
A Credit Analyst reviews credit history and researches other records to determine if loans should be approved or credit extended to individuals or businesses. Prepares reports for banks, credit agencies and credit card companies.

The Merchant Services Senior Credit Analyst analyzes financial statements, management profiles, business/product cycles, and cash flow ability to develop an assessment of credit risk including reviewing in-depth historical operating performance. This job develops assessment/summary by identifying key strengths and risks, reviewing historical operating performance, and recommending risk rating. It performs quality underwriting for merchant services relationship requests and may begin to analyze requests in a specific industry that are complex in structure, or of a large market nature. The Senior Credit Analyst approves merchant applications within established merchant credit policy and individual credit authority.Depth & Scope:
Accountable for larger, more complex credits and have higher approval limits Analyzes financial statements, management profiles, business/product cycles, and cash flow ability to develop an assessment of credit risk including reviewing in-depth historical operating performance Develops assessment/summary by identifying key strengths and risks, recommending a decision and a risk rating Independently discusses and recommends alternative structures, overall assessments, and any outstanding requirements with merchant Sales Reps Performs quality underwriting for merchant application requests May begin to analyze requests in a specific industry, that are complex in structure, or of a large market nature Approves and/or recommends accounts within established merchant credit policy and individual credit approval limit authority Independently prepares analyses for designated merchant accounts that includes identifying any deviations from the merchant policy, recommending processing or reserve changes in order to preserve profitability, reduce credit risk and merchant exposure Performs a financial analysis on customer-provided or bank-generated projections including the performance of "what-if" scenarios that test the reasonableness of the projections provided to the Company Collects and maintains industry data from outside sources, including conversations with the borrower, industry publications, payment card network information, etc to assist with approach to risk assessment Participates in and/or assists in leading internal training activities to sales and customer service employees.
